Don't insert ASCII character with ctrl(w/o/ alt) or meta is on.
On Gtk/Linux, it emits key events with ASCII text and ctrl on for ctrl-<x>. In WebKit, EditorClient::handleKeyboardEvent in WebKit/gtk/WebCoreSupport/EditorClientGtk.cpp drops such events. On Mac, it emits key events with ASCII text and meta is on for Command-<x>. These key events should not emit text insert event. Alt key would be used to insert alternative character, so we should let through. Ctrl-Alt combination may equal to AltGr key, which is also used to insert alternative character. In summary, we can't think of a scenario where you'd use control(w/o alt) or meta to do insertion of a ASCII character.
